Millennium's teams pursue strategies as disparate asrelative value fundamental equity, statistical arbitrage, merger arbitrage, or straight-up fixed income and commodity investing, but they all have one thing in common: they only invest in highly liquid products. Englander, Feeney, Stone and Pillai knew that mutual funds sought to detect market timers and frequently blocked Millennium's trades and, therefore, devised and carried out various fraudulent means to conceal Millennium's identity and thereby avoid detection and circumvent restrictions that the mutual funds imposed on market timing. Five years ago, for example, Chris Dale, one of its longest serving employees, who ran one of its largest trading books in Europe, was ejected after making a 5% loss over a short period. - No matter that Dale claimed to have made $450min the eight years previously: Englander's tolerance for losses is notoriously low.
